梯形花键的测绘与设计

摘  要:梯形花键具有导向性好、自动定心等特点,在低速、大转矩传动领域有着广泛的应用。文中运用平面解析几何的方法,分析未知梯形花键不同直径量棒的跨棒距差别,推导花键的相关参数。同时推导零侧隙梯形花键副内外花键量棒与跨棒距间的数值关系,以及花键齿侧间隙与跨棒距的数值关系,为梯形花键的测绘与设计提供了一定的参考。Trapezoidal spline has the characteristics of good guiding and automatic centering,which has certain applications in the field of low-speed and large-torque transmission.This paper uses the method of plane analytic geometry to analyze the difference of spline dimension over two pins of unknown trapezoidal splines with different diameters of measuring pins,and to deduce the relevant parameters of the splines.At the same time,we deduce the numerical relationship between the inside and outside spline measuring pins and spline dimension over two pins of the trapezoidal spline with zero side clearance,and the numerical relationship between the spline tooth side clearance and the spline dimension over two pins,which provide certain reference for the mapping and design of trapezoidal spline.
